Calcolatrice per Calcoli con le Ore
Inserisci i valori per calcolare conversioni, differenze e operazioni con le ore in modo preciso.
Guida Completa ai Calcoli con le Ore: Conversioni, Operazioni e Applicazioni Pratiche
I calcoli con le ore sono fondamentali in numerosi contesti, dalla gestione del tempo lavorativo alla programmazione di attività quotidiane. Questa guida approfondita esplorerà tutti gli aspetti essenziali per padroneggiare le operazioni con le ore, includendo conversioni tra formati, calcoli di differenze, e applicazioni pratiche nel mondo reale.
1. Fondamenti dei Calcoli con le Ore
Il sistema orario si basa su:
- 24 ore in un giorno (formato 24h)
- 60 minuti in un’ora
- 60 secondi in un minuto
- 3600 secondi in un’ora (60 × 60)
Queste relazioni matematiche sono alla base di tutte le conversioni tra unità di tempo.
2. Conversioni tra Formati Orari
2.1. Da Formato 24h a 12h (AM/PM)
La conversione tra i due formati più comuni richiede attenzione alle ore:
- 00:00 – 00:59 → 12:00 AM – 12:59 AM
- 01:00 – 11:59 → 01:00 AM – 11:59 AM
- 12:00 – 12:59 → 12:00 PM – 12:59 PM
- 13:00 – 23:59 → 01:00 PM – 11:59 PM
2.2. Da Ore a Secondi e Viceversa
Per convertire le ore in secondi:
Secondi = (Ore × 3600) + (Minuti × 60) + Secondi
Per la conversione inversa:
- Dividi i secondi totali per 3600 per ottenere le ore
- Prendi il resto e dividi per 60 per ottenere i minuti
- Il resto finale saranno i secondi
3. Operazioni Matematiche con le Ore
3.1. Addizione e Sottrazione
Quando si aggiungono o sottraggono ore, è essenziale gestire correttamente i “riporti”:
- Se i secondi superano 59 → aggiungi 1 ai minuti e sottrai 60 dai secondi
- Se i minuti superano 59 → aggiungi 1 alle ore e sottrai 60 dai minuti
- Se le ore superano 23 → torna a 0 e aggiungi 1 al giorno (nel formato 24h)
3.2. Calcolo delle Differenze
Per trovare la differenza tra due orari:
- Converti entrambi gli orari in secondi dall’inizio del giorno (00:00:00)
- Sottrai il valore più piccolo da quello più grande
- Converti il risultato in ore:minuti:secondi
4. Applicazioni Pratiche
4.1. Gestione del Tempo Lavorativo
I calcoli con le ore sono cruciali per:
- Calcolo degli straordinari
- Pianificazione dei turni
- Tracciamento della produttività
| Settore | Applicazione Tipica | Frequenza d’Uso |
|---|---|---|
| Sanità | Turni infermieristici | Giornaliera |
| Logistica | Tempi di consegna | Oraria |
| Istruzione | Orari lezioni | Settimanale |
| Manifatturiero | Tempi produzione | Continuativa |
4.2. Pianificazione di Progetti
Nella gestione dei progetti, i calcoli temporali permettono di:
- Stimare le tempistiche
- Allocare risorse
- Monitorare i progressi
5. Errori Comuni e Come Evitarli
5.1. Dimenticare i Riporti
Un errore frequente è non gestire correttamente il riporto quando minuti o secondi superano 59. Ad esempio:
Errato: 23:59 + 00:02 = 23:61
Corretto: 23:59 + 00:02 = 00:01 (del giorno successivo)
5.2. Confondere AM e PM
Nel formato 12h, è facile confondere:
- 12:00 AM (mezzanotte) con 12:00 PM (mezzo giorno)
- Le ore dopo mezzogiorno (1 PM = 13:00)
6. Strumenti e Risorse Utili
Per approfondire:
- National Institute of Standards and Technology – Divisione Tempo e Frequenza (standard internazionali)
- Definizione ufficiale del secondo (NIST)
- Time and Date (calcolatrici e convertitori online)
7. Esempi Pratici con Soluzioni
7.1. Conversione in Secondi
Problema: Converti 3 ore, 45 minuti e 30 secondi in secondi totali.
Soluzione:
- 3 ore × 3600 = 10800 secondi
- 45 minuti × 60 = 2700 secondi
- 30 secondi = 30 secondi
- Totale = 10800 + 2700 + 30 = 13530 secondi
7.2. Differenza tra Orari
Problema: Qual è la differenza tra 14:30:15 e 09:45:30?
Soluzione:
- Converti entrambi in secondi:
- 14:30:15 = (14×3600) + (30×60) + 15 = 52215 secondi
- 09:45:30 = (9×3600) + (45×60) + 30 = 35130 secondi
- Differenza = 52215 – 35130 = 17085 secondi
- Converti indietro:
- 17085 ÷ 3600 = 4 ore (resto 2685)
- 2685 ÷ 60 = 44 minuti (resto 45)
- 45 secondi
- Risultato: 4 ore, 44 minuti e 45 secondi
8. Calcoli con le Ore in Programmazione
Nei linguaggi di programmazione, le librerie più utilizzate sono:
| Linguaggio | Libreria/Package | Funzionalità Chiave |
|---|---|---|
| JavaScript | Date object | Gestione completa di date e orari |
| Python | datetime | Operazioni aritmetiche con orari |
| Java | java.time | API moderna per gestione tempo |
| C# | DateTime | Formattazione e calcoli |
9. Standard Internazionali
Gli standard più importanti per la misurazione del tempo sono:
- UTC (Tempo Coordinato Universale): Standard primario per il tempo nel mondo
- ISO 8601: Formato standard per rappresentazione di date e orari (YYYY-MM-DDTHH:MM:SS)
- TAI (Tempo Atomico Internazionale): Basato su orologi atomici
10. Curiosità sul Tempo
Alcuni fatti interessanti:
- Il giorno solare medio è di 24 ore, 3 minuti e 56.555 secondi
- Gli orologi atomici sono precisi fino a 1 secondo ogni 100 milioni di anni
- Il fuso orario più avanzato è UTC+14 (Isole Line)
- Il più arretrato è UTC-12 (Isole Baker e Howland)
11. Consigli per Calcoli Precisi
- Utilizza sempre il formato 24h per evitare ambiguità
- Verifica sempre i riporti tra secondi, minuti e ore
- Per calcoli complessi, considera l’utilizzo di librerie specializzate
- Documenta sempre le tue conversioni per tracciabilità
- Testa i tuoi calcoli con valori limite (00:00:00, 23:59:59)
12. Errori Storici Legati al Tempo
Alcuni errori famosi:
- Mars Climate Orbiter (1999): Perdita della sonda da 125 milioni di dollari a causa di un errore di conversione tra unità metriche e imperiali nei calcoli temporali
- Problema informatico dovuto alla rappresentazione degli anni con sole 2 cifre (es. “99” invece di “1999”)
- Ore legali: Errori nella programmazione dei cambi dell’ora legale hanno causato disservizi in numerosi sistemi informatici